Thank you for your interest in the graduate programs offered at the University of North Carolina School of the Arts. The School of Design and Production and the School of Filmmaking offer a Master of Fine Arts degree and the School of Music offers a Master of Music degree and Performing Arts Certificate. Application

  1. Please fill out the application as thoroughly as possible.
  2. You can log in later and resume your application or make changes by clicking the 'Save' button.
  3. Your failure to provide complete, accurate, and truthful information on this application will be grounds to deny or withdraw your admission, or dismiss you after enrollment.
  4. When you are finished, click the 'SUBMIT' button on the left column of any application screen.
  5. You cannot make changes to your application after it has been submitted.
  6. If you are applying to 2 different arts departments, you must complete a second application and submit a second application fee.

Application Agreement Statement and Payment

  1. Print the application agreement statement that appears after you submit the application. Mail the signed agreement statement to the Office of Admissions, 1533 South Main Street, Winston-Salem, NC 27127.
  2. If you did not pay by credit card, please send the application agreement statement along with your non-refundable $60 application fee (U.S. citizens or Permanent Residents) or $110 (international applicants) to the Office of Admissions, 1533 South Main Street, Winston-Salem, NC 27127.
  3. International Applicants should submit with the application a nonrefundable application fee of $110 payable in U.S. dollars.  Checks or money orders should be made payable to UNCSA. Wiring Instructions are available on this link: Wiring Instructions.
